开发者社区> 问答> 正文

OceanBase数据库4.2.0我这边是会提示列名;但是为何越界?

OceanBase数据库4.2.0我这边是会提示列名;但是为何越界?

展开
收起
十一0204 2023-10-17 13:14:06 146 0
来自:OceanBase
1 条回答
写回答
取消 提交回答
  • OceanBase数据库的错误提示"越界"可能有很多原因。通常,这种错误是在尝试访问数组、集合或数据结构的范围之外时出现的。以下是一些可能的原因和解决方案:

    1.查询语句错误:请检查查询语句是否正确。错误的查询语句可能会导致越界错误。确保您在查询中使用的列名正确,并且没有任何语法错误。
    2.数据类型不匹配:检查您查询中使用的数据类型是否与表结构中的数据类型匹配。如果类型不匹配,可能会导致越界错误。确保您在查询中使用正确的数据类型。
    3.访问权限问题:确认您是否有足够的权限访问所查询的表和列。如果没有足够的权限,可能会导致越界错误。请与数据库管理员联系,确保您的权限设置正确。
    4.表或列不存在:确认您查询的表和列是否存在。如果表或列不存在,可能会导致越界错误。请检查表和列的命名是否正确,并确保它们在数据库中存在。
    5.超出了最大行数:OceanBase数据库中每个表都有最大行数的限制。如果您查询的表已经达到了最大行数,可能会导致越界错误。请检查您查询的表中是否有超出最大行数的数据行。
    如果以上解决方案均不能解决问题,建议您提供更多详细信息,例如错误提示、查询语句和相关代码等,以便更好地帮助您解决问题。

    2023-10-17 13:44:29
    赞同 展开评论 打赏
来源圈子
更多
收录在圈子:
+ 订阅
蚂蚁OceanBase数据库团队,用于OceanBase技术原理、运维经验和案例分享、对外交流。
问答排行榜
最热
最新

相关电子书

更多
开源HTAP OceanBase产品揭秘 立即下载
云数据库OceanBase 架构演进及在金融核心系统中的实践 立即下载
自研金融数据库OceanBase的创新之路 立即下载